Loop8 Launches Free Privacy App Without Master Password

News related to:Loop8 Inc · 2 min read

Loop8, a privacy controller app, has launched its free version to the public, offering a secure alternative to traditional password managers and secure note apps. The app, available on both iOS and Android, aims to simplify personal data management while ensuring robust security.

Users can access Loop8 using their phone's biometrics, eliminating the need for a master password, which is often a source of security vulnerabilities. The app includes several features designed to enhance privacy and security:

- Note8: A simple notes app that protects sensitive information with biometric security. - True8 Connect: A private messaging platform that automatically deletes messages after eight days, ensuring no traces remain. - Authenticator: A two-factor authentication tool that generates codes on the device, providing an additional layer of security. - PrivacyMate: A service that scans the dark web for any compromised data related to the user, providing real-time alerts.

The free version of Loop8 is now available on the App Store for iOS devices and on Google Play for Android. Users can download and use the app without registering with personal details such as a name, age, or gender. The app stores no data on its servers, ensuring that user information remains entirely on the user's own devices or in their cloud accounts.

For an enhanced experience, the paid version offers additional features: - Password Manager: Securely stores and manages user credentials, with no master password required. - MySafe: A desktop tool that keeps data on the user’s computer and can be backed up to an external storage solution, such as a Google Drive.

According to Zarik Megerdichian, the founder and CEO of Loop8, "Most people aren't security experts, and they shouldn't have to be. We built Loop8 for everyone else. It's simple, and there's nothing for you to manage."

In the event of a lost device, the app’s encrypted backup remains secure. Trusted contacts can help regain access, ensuring that the user’s data remains protected. Unlike other password managers and secure note apps that store user data on company servers, Loop8 does not maintain any copies of user information, significantly reducing the risk of data breaches.

Megerdichian added, "The master password had a good run. As of today, people have another option."

The app is currently free on both the Apple App Store and Google Play, offering a comprehensive privacy controller for all users. With the growing concern over data security and privacy, Loop8 aims to provide a user-friendly and secure solution to manage personal information.
